如何在Ebsilon软件中进行数据挖掘和文本挖掘?
Ebsilon软件是一种功能强大的数据挖掘和文本挖掘工具,它可以帮助用户从大量数据中提取有价值的信息。在本文中,我们将详细介绍如何在Ebsilon软件中进行数据挖掘和文本挖掘。
一、数据挖掘
- 数据准备
在进行数据挖掘之前,首先要对数据进行准备。在Ebsilon软件中,可以通过以下步骤进行数据准备:
(1)导入数据:支持多种数据格式,如CSV、Excel、数据库等。
(2)数据清洗:去除重复数据、处理缺失值、修正错误数据等。
(3)数据转换:将数据转换为适合挖掘的格式,如归一化、标准化等。
- 模型选择
Ebsilon软件提供了多种数据挖掘模型,包括分类、回归、聚类、关联规则等。以下是几种常用的模型:
(1)分类模型:用于预测离散标签,如决策树、支持向量机、神经网络等。
(2)回归模型:用于预测连续值,如线性回归、岭回归、LASSO回归等。
(3)聚类模型:用于将数据划分为若干个簇,如K-means、层次聚类等。
(4)关联规则挖掘:用于发现数据之间的关联关系,如Apriori算法、FP-growth算法等。
- 模型训练与评估
(1)模型训练:将准备好的数据集划分为训练集和测试集,使用训练集对模型进行训练。
(2)模型评估:使用测试集对训练好的模型进行评估,如准确率、召回率、F1值等。
- 模型优化
根据模型评估结果,对模型进行优化,如调整参数、选择更合适的模型等。
二、文本挖掘
- 文本预处理
在进行文本挖掘之前,首先要对文本进行预处理。在Ebsilon软件中,可以通过以下步骤进行文本预处理:
(1)分词:将文本分割成单词或短语。
(2)去除停用词:去除无意义的词汇,如“的”、“是”、“在”等。
(3)词性标注:对每个单词进行词性标注,如名词、动词、形容词等。
- 文本特征提取
(1)词频-逆文档频率(TF-IDF):根据词频和逆文档频率计算每个词的重要性。
(2)词嵌入:将文本表示为向量,如Word2Vec、GloVe等。
(3)主题模型:如LDA(Latent Dirichlet Allocation)等,用于发现文本中的主题。
- 文本分类与聚类
(1)文本分类:将文本数据划分为不同的类别,如情感分析、主题分类等。
(2)文本聚类:将文本数据划分为若干个簇,如基于LDA的文本聚类。
- 文本可视化
(1)词云:根据词频生成词云,直观地展示文本中的重要词汇。
(2)主题分布图:展示文本中不同主题的分布情况。
三、总结
Ebsilon软件是一款功能强大的数据挖掘和文本挖掘工具,它可以帮助用户从大量数据中提取有价值的信息。通过以上步骤,用户可以在Ebsilon软件中进行数据挖掘和文本挖掘,从而为决策提供有力支持。在实际应用中,用户可以根据具体需求选择合适的模型和算法,以达到最佳效果。
猜你喜欢:CAD软件